1 Ceres punika satunggilng planet kerdhil wonten ing sabuk asteroid. Ceres kapanggihaken ing tanggal 1 Januari 1801 déning Giuseppe Piazzi. Wiwitanipun nalika kapanggih Ceres kaanggep satunggiling planèt, nanging setengah abad salajengipun lan antawisipun 150 taun salajengipun, Ceres dipunklasifikasi dados satunggiling asteroid. Ing tanggal 24 Agustus 2006, Persatuan Astronomi Internasional mutusaken kanggé ngéwahi status Ceres dados "planet kerdhil".
Ceres anggadhahi massa 9,45±0,04 × 1020 kg. Kanthi dhiameter kirang langkung 950 km, Ceres punika benda angkasa paling ageng ing sabuk asteroid utami.
